By a News Reporter-Staff News Editor at Robotics & Machine Learning Daily News Daily News – Current study results on Robotics have been published. According to news reporting originating from Montreal, Canada, by NewsRx correspondents, research stated, “Many people are fascinated by biolog ical swarms, but understanding the behavior and inherent task objectives of a bi rd flock or ant colony requires training. Whereas several swarm intelligence wor ks focus on mimicking natural swarm behaviors, we argue that this may not be the most intuitive approach to facilitate communication with the operators.”
